Is it possible to so, please, observe my example:

Script1.sikuli contents:

import Script2
Script2.runScript2()

Script2.sikuli contents:

def runScript2():
    print("Try to click")
    click("Screen Shot 2019-01-06 at 18.17.22.png")
    print("DONE")


I run Script1 and get console output:

Try to click
[error] script [ Script1 ] stopped with error in line 2
[error] NameError ( global name 'click' is not defined )

[error] --- Traceback --- error source first
line: module ( function ) statement 
3: Script2 ( runScript2 ) click("Screen Shot 2019-01-06 at 18.17.22.png")
[error] --- Traceback --- end --------------


Why global name 'click' is not defined? Can you provide the right way
how to run script from another script? Is it possible with IDE to so?
Thanks.
